Tax Compliance Manager | $120,000-$150,000 + Comprehensive Benefits
Location: Tampa, FL (In-Office) | Full-Time
A global manufacturing leader is seeking a highly skilled and detail-oriented Tax Compliance Manager to lead federal and state income tax compliance efforts at its newly relocated headquarters in Tampa, FL. This is an exciting opportunity to join a well-established organization during a transformative period, with strong leadership and a collaborative, modern office environment.
The Tax Compliance Manager will oversee complex tax filings, planning initiatives, and audit defense, while ensuring compliance with evolving tax regulations. This role offers high visibility and the chance to work alongside seasoned professionals with Big 4 backgrounds.
What You’ll Do:
Tax Compliance
- Prepare federal consolidated Form 1120 and multiple state income tax returns using CORPTAX
- Reconcile tax depreciation and prepare Forms 4562, 4626, and 4797
- Manage all book-to-tax adjustments including bonus depreciation, UNICAP, Section 163(j), etc.
- Upload international tax packs for Forms 5471, 8858, and 8865
- Compute apportionment and state tax modifications
- Assess nexus and determine required tax filings
- Prepare extensions and estimated tax payments
Tax Planning
- Oversee domestic and state tax issues related to acquisitions, dispositions, restructurings, and general planning
- Monitor and interpret changes in U.S. and state tax laws
Tax Accounting
- Maintain inventory of federal deferred taxes and permanent adjustments (e.g., meals & entertainment, lobbying)
- Compute provision-to-return adjustments
- Prepare year-end tax provision inputs including:
- NOL expiration and valuation allowance analysis
- State FIN 48
- State effective tax rate
- Bonus depreciation deferred tax adjustments
- Current state tax accruals
Audit Defense
- Lead defense efforts for IRS and state tax audits
What You Bring:
-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ting required; Master’s degree and/or CPA preferred
- Minimum of 8 years of relevant experience in public accounting and/or industry
- Required: CORPTAX experience
- Preferred: ASC 740 knowledge; experience with AS400, Onstream, and Alteryx
- Proven ability to manage multiple staff and meet tight deadlines
- Strong technical expertise and attention to detail
